Как передать аргумент командной строки в приложении .net Windows - PullRequest
1 голос
/ 04 октября 2011

я хочу передать аргумент в c # .net консольному приложению, которое я пробовал ProcessStartInfo, но это можно использовать для немедленного запуска приложения ... но я хочу установить аргументы для приложения, которое будет запущено в запланированное время

1 Ответ

1 голос
/ 04 октября 2011

Используйте правильные аргументы для передачи аргументов командной строки

http://msdn.microsoft.com/en-us/library/system.diagnostics.processstartinfo.arguments.aspx

Пример:

  var info = new System.Diagnostics.ProcessStartInfo();
  info.FileName = "cmd.exe";
  info.Arguments = "/C";
  info.UseShellExecute = true;
  var process = new System.Diagnostics.Process();
  process.StartInfo = info;

  process.Start();
  process.WaitForExit();
...